Two-Day Cappadocia Trip with Overnight Stay
Cappadocia’s majestic rock formations, rolling landscapes, scenic trails, mysterious underground cities, and rock-carved churches make it one of Turkey’s most amazing destinations. This region combines natural wonder with human craftsmanship — a must-see at least once in a lifetime.
Göreme Valley and the Open-Air Museum, a UNESCO World Heritage site, are at the heart of Anatolia. The region is famous for its “fairy chimneys” and ancient cave temples hundreds of years old.
Don’t miss the sunset and the incredible sight of hundreds of hot-air balloons floating over the valleys.
Bursa Sightseeing Tour
Bursa was once under Roman and Byzantine rule and later became the first capital of the Ottoman Empire. This historic city is full of fascinating sites and monuments.
In 2014, Bursa was recognized as a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Nearby İznik (ancient Nicaea) hosted the First Council of Nicaea in 325 AD, convened by Emperor Constantine the Great. During the Second Vatican Council in 1962, Nicaea was called the “third holy city” after Jerusalem and Vatican City.
The charming village of Cumalıkızık, also a UNESCO World Heritage Site, preserves its authentic Ottoman character.
